Below is a list of questions for this book that are available in WebAssign. These questions are exactly the same as the questions in your textbook except for minor wording changes to make them work in a web environment. As often as possible, variables, numbers, or words have been randomized so that each student will receive a unique version.

Questions listed in black are ready for immediate use in an assignment. Questions in blue are under development, and should be available shortly. This list is updated nightly. Please contact WebAssign if you need access to a blue question or additional questions from this textbook.

You may duplicate a question and change it as you like for your class.
